Prediction of SNOs between GOES-16 and METOP-C Satellite Orbit:

Table of predicted SNOs for the next 14.0 days since TLE Epoch: 10/7/2023
Index Date Time (GOES-16) GOES-16 Lat,Lon METOP-C Lat,Lon Distance(km) Time Diff (sec)
1 10/07/2023 02:35:39 0.04, -75.20 -0.33, -76.90 194.06 80
2 10/08/2023 02:17:41 0.04, -75.20 0.79, -71.91 375.29 80
3 10/09/2023 14:33:52 -0.04, -75.23 0.26, -76.46 140.63 80
4 10/10/2023 14:13:14 -0.04, -75.24 -0.87, -71.47 429.24 80
5 10/12/2023 02:34:56 0.04, -75.23 -0.16, -76.07 95.98 80
6 10/13/2023 02:11:38 0.04, -75.24 0.97, -71.08 474.34 80
7 10/14/2023 14:33:09 -0.04, -75.29 0.06, -75.64 40.28 80
8 10/17/2023 02:28:53 0.04, -75.30 0.07, -75.25 6.43 80
9 10/19/2023 14:29:45 -0.03, -75.36 -0.13, -74.80 62.48 80
